Competitors per class (approx 30 riders)
Classes 2-4 will all have a timed section to include a gate. Class 1 will be timed from start to finish.
Competitors will be eliminated after 3 refusals at one jump, 4 refusals in total over the whole course or 2 rider falls.
Medical armbands and body protectors must be worn. Please ensure you check the new Hat standards to ensure you are wearing the correct hat.

Terms & Conditions
1. 3 refusals at one fence, 4 refusals throughout the course and 2 rider falls results in elimination. 2. No horse/pony may enter more than two classes. No horse/pony may com-pete more than once in any class. 3. This event will be run in accordance with Pony Club eventing 2016 rules. This includes the wearing of Medical Armbands and Body Protectors by all competitors . Hard Hats Must be worn with chinstrap fastened at all times when mounted. Tagged hats will only be accepted if they have a white pony club tag or red British Eventing tag. 4.Competitors must wear Hats of a similar standard ie: PAS015: 1998 or 2011 with BSI Kite mark,VG1 with BSI Kite mark, Snell E2001 with the official Snell label & number, ASTM-F1163 2004A With the SEI mark, AS/NZS 3838 1998, 2003 or 2006. A jockey skull cap with no fixed peak must be worn for Cross Country, by all competitors. 5. Bagnum Equestrian reserve the right to refuse any entry, alter advertised times, cancel any class or divide a class without stating the reason. 6. The course may be walked from 2.00pm-6pm, Saturday 30th April. 7. £5 deposit will be required for number bibs. 8. Rosettes will be awarded to 6th place. 9. Under no circumstances will entry fees be refunded due to cancellation by competitors (unless accompanied by a veterinary certificate). 10. Bagnum Equestrian Centre reserves the right to refuse or cancel any entry or entries of any person if they shall deem it fit to do so without reason for do-ing so. 11. The judge may disqualify any competitor for misuse of whips or spurs. 12. Dung must not be left in the lorry/trailer park

VACCINATION CERTIFICATES – The Passport/vaccination Certificate must, under penalty of elimination, accompany the horse to all official competitions, the competitor is responsible for producing it on demand.
